Looking for some advice/opinions...
Planning on putting new spark plugs in. I'm torn between putting in the updated Motorcraft Platinum SP-493 or NGK IX Iridium 7164.
I've read that the Iridium perform/last longer, but the car wasn't designed/built for Iridium.
Am I way overthinking this?

Just get whatever you want. Yes iridium and all the other stuff do last longer so new cars don't have to change their plugs as often. That is the sole reason
for any plug that's not copper. Copper does everything better except latsing.
If you are running any type of boost use copper. If the car starts leaning out they should melt (so says the theory) and hopefully
no expensive damage. I don't buy into that but, they do produce better spark by far and are much cheaper.
